The AI-Powered Plant Reliability & Loss Prediction System is a comprehensive Excel-based solution designed to help industrial plants identify hidden downtime risks, predict equipment failures, and quantify the true financial impact of poor reliability.

Most operations are aware of recurring failures in conveyors, gearboxes, motors, and critical assets—but very few can clearly quantify what those failures are costing the business. This system bridges that gap by combining engineering reliability principles with financial modeling, transforming maintenance data into actionable business insights.

At its core, the tool functions as a practical "digital twin" of your plant. Users input key parameters such as throughput, operating hours, equipment reliability (MTBF/MTTR), and condition data. The system then simulates failure behavior, calculates lost production, and converts downtime into monetary loss (R/month).

A key differentiator is the integrated AI-assisted diagnostic engine. By entering observed symptoms such as vibration, temperature, or abnormal noise, the system predicts the most likely failure mode, assigns a probability and confidence level, and recommends targeted actions. This intelligence is automatically linked across the model—adjusting failure risk, asset ranking, and financial exposure.

The system delivers:

Executive dashboards highlighting total plant losses and availability
Identification of top 5 high-risk assets driving downtime
AI-driven failure predictions and maintenance recommendations
Risk-based maintenance prioritization (RBM)
Scenario analysis to evaluate improvement strategies
AI-adjusted financial impact for decision-making
